
The Musical Alphabet Arranged Expressly For the Instruction and Amusement of Children
New York: E.S. Mesier, [ca. 1835].
Folio. Unbound.4 pp. Lithographed. Printed on quality light gray wove paper.
Scored for voice and piano. Each letter from A-Z is accompanied by one or more small lithographic illustrations (an apple, an archer, a bull, a bear, a cat, etc.), for a total of 31 illustrations, drawn by J. Probst and lithographed by Mesier.
Very slightly worn and soiled; spine partially separated, with miniscule sewing holes; remnants of mounting tape to blank inner margin of verso of second leaf.
First published by the composer in London in 1830.
